Environmental Benefits

I’m really impressed by the environmental benefits of this technology.

Open loop geothermal energy is a renewable energy source that offers significant reductions in carbon footprint. By utilizing the heat from underground water sources, this system eliminates the need for traditional heating and cooling methods that rely on fossil fuels. This leads to a substantial decrease in greenhouse gas emissions, contributing to a cleaner and healthier environment.

Additionally, open loop geothermal energy doesn’t produce any harmful byproducts, such as air pollutants or toxic waste materials. With its sustainable nature and minimal environmental impact, this technology is a promising solution for reducing our reliance on non-renewable energy sources.

Are There Any Specific Geographical or Geological Requirements for Installing an Open Loop Geothermal System?

Specific geographical and geological requirements must be met to install an open loop geothermal system. These include suitable hydrogeological conditions, such as the presence of a sufficient and accessible groundwater source, and proper land availability for drilling and installation.

What Are the Potential Risks or Drawbacks Associated With Using Open Loop Geothermal Energy?

Potential risks and drawbacks of open loop geothermal energy include potential environmental impact, such as groundwater contamination, and the need for regular maintenance and monitoring to ensure proper system performance.
